如何访问linux服务器图片不显示不出来

worktile 其他 455

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如果在访问Linux服务器时出现图片不显示的问题,可能是由于以下几个原因导致的:网络问题、文件路径问题、文件权限问题、缺少相应的软件。

    首先,要确保网络连接正常。可以尝试使用ping命令来测试是否可以连接到服务器。如果网络连接正常,就需要检查文件路径是否正确。图片文件路径应该与HTML代码中的路径一致。

    其次,要检查图片文件的权限是否正确。在Linux系统中,可以使用chmod命令来设置文件权限。确保图片文件具有可读权限,可以使用以下命令来设置权限:

    chmod +r 图片文件路径
    

    另外,还需要确保服务器上安装了正确的图像处理软件。如果服务器上没有安装相关的软件,那么即使图片文件路径和权限设置都正确,图片也无法显示。可以使用以下命令来检查是否安装了所需的软件:

    which 图像处理软件名称
    

    如果软件没有安装,可以使用以下命令来安装:

    sudo apt-get install 图像处理软件名称
    

    最后,如果以上步骤都没有解决问题,可能还需要检查HTML代码中是否存在错误,或者尝试在其他设备上访问同一服务器来确定问题是否与特定设备有关。

    总结:要解决Linux服务器上图片不显示的问题,首先要确保网络连接正常,然后检查文件路径和权限设置是否正确,确保服务器上安装了正确的图像处理软件。如果问题仍然存在,可以检查HTML代码或尝试使用其他设备来访问服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论
    1. 确认图像路径是否正确:首先,检查你所访问的图像路径是否正确。确保图像文件存在于正确的位置,并且路径是准确的。可以通过使用命令"ls"来列出当前目录的文件和文件夹,以确保图像文件在该目录中。

    2. 权限设置:确保图像文件的权限设置正确。在Linux中,每个文件和目录都有一个权限设置,决定了用户可以对其进行哪些操作。使用命令"ls -l"可以查看文件的权限设置。如果图像文件的权限设置不正确,可以使用命令"chmod"来更改权限。例如,"chmod 644 image.jpg"将图像文件的权限设置为644,这意味着所有者可以读写,其他用户只能读取。

    3. 网络连接问题:如果你是通过网络连接到Linux服务器,并且无法显示图像,可能存在网络连接问题。确保你的网络连接正常,并且服务器的网络配置正确。可以尝试通过其他网络连接或设备访问服务器上的图像,以确定是否是网络问题。

    4. 检查浏览器设置:有时候,浏览器的设置或插件可能会导致图像无法显示。你可以尝试在不同的浏览器中打开图像,或者在当前浏览器的隐私设置中禁用图像的阻止功能。另外,检查是否有针对特定网站的广告拦截程序或脚本拦截图像的加载。

    5. 图像格式问题:最后,确保你使用的图像格式被服务器支持。常见的图像格式如JPEG、PNG等在大多数情况下都能够正常显示。如果你使用的是特殊的或不常见的图像格式,可能需要安装相应的解码器或插件才能正确显示图像。

    总结:
    访问Linux服务器上的图像不显示的问题可能有多种原因。首先,检查图像路径是否正确以及文件权限设置是否正确。其次,确保网络连接正常,并检查浏览器的设置以及图像格式是否被服务器支持。如果问题仍然存在,可以尝试使用其他设备或网络连接来访问服务器上的图像,以更进一步地确定问题所在。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    访问 Linux 服务器时,如果图片无法显示或加载,请考虑以下几个方面的问题及解决方法:

    1. 检查图片路径是否正确:确认图片文件是否存在于所指定的路径中,并且该路径是否正确指向图片。

    2. 检查文件权限:确认图片文件和所在目录的权限是否正确设置。使用命令 ls -l 可以查看文件和目录的权限信息,使用命令 chmod 可以修改文件和目录的权限。

    3. 检查图片格式:确保服务器支持所使用的图片格式,例如 JPEG、PNG 等。如果服务器不支持某个格式,图片将无法正常显示。

    4. 检查图片文件是否完整:如果图片文件损坏或不完整,可能无法正确显示。可以使用 md5sumsha256sum 命令检查文件完整性,或者尝试重新下载或拷贝图片文件。

    5. 检查 web 服务器的配置文件:如果使用的是 web 服务器(如 Apache 或 Nginx),请检查服务器的配置文件,确保正确配置了图片文件的路径和访问权限。如果使用的是其他类型的服务器,也需要检查相应的配置文件。

    6. 检查网络连接和防火墙设置:如果服务器与访问者之间存在网络连接问题或防火墙设置导致的连接问题,图片可能无法正常加载。请确保服务器和访问者之间可以正常通信,并且防火墙设置允许图片的访问。

    7. 检查 HTML 代码和路径:如果使用 HTML 引用图片,确保 HTML 代码中的图片路径是正确的,并且可以从服务器访问到图片。可以尝试手动在浏览器中输入图片的 URL 地址来检查是否能够正常访问。

    8. 检查浏览器设置:有时候浏览器的设置可能导致图片无法显示,可以尝试清除浏览器缓存、禁用插件或更换浏览器来测试是否可以显示图片。

    以上是一些可能导致 Linux 服务器图片无法显示的常见问题和解决方法,根据具体情况进行逐步排查和调试即可解决问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部